Types of Floor Paint


There are several types of floor paint available in Lexington, each with unique features and benefits:


  • Epoxy Floor Paint: Epoxy floor paint is a two-part system that creates a strong, glossy finish. It is ideal for high-traffic areas such as garages and workshops due to its durability and resistance to chemicals and abrasions.


  • Concrete Floor Paint: Designed specifically for concrete surfaces, this type of paint offers protection against moisture, stains, and wear. It comes in a wide array of colors and finishes, giving you plenty of options to achieve your desired look.


  • Latex Floor Paint: Latex floor paint is water-based and suitable for wood and concrete floors. It is easy to apply and clean up, making it a popular choice for DIY projects.


  • Urethane Floor Paint: Urethane paint offers exceptional durability and chemical resistance. It is often used in industrial settings but can also be applied to residential floors for a long-lasting finish.


  • Decorative Floor Paint: Decorative floor paints, such as those with metallic or textured finishes, add a unique and stylish touch to your floors. These paints are often used for artistic designs or accent areas.

Tips for Applying Floor Paint


Follow these tips for a successful floor painting project:


  • Prepare the Surface: Proper surface preparation is essential for good adhesion and a smooth finish. Clean the surface thoroughly, repair any cracks or damage, and apply a primer if needed.


  • Choose the Right Tools: Use high-quality brushes, rollers, or sprayers depending on the type of paint and surface. Follow the manufacturer's recommendations for application tools.


  • Apply Multiple Coats: Apply at least two coats of paint for even coverage and depth of color. Allow sufficient drying time between coats, as per the manufacturer's instructions.


  • Maintain Ideal Conditions: Paint in a well-ventilated area with moderate temperatures and low humidity. Avoid painting in extreme weather conditions, as this can affect drying times and paint performance.


  • Follow Safety Precautions: Wear appropriate safety gear such as gloves and masks when handling paint and primers. Make sure the area is properly ventilated to prevent breathing in fumes.

FAQs


  1. Can I use regular wall paint on floors?

  • No, regular wall paint is not designed for use on floors and may not provide the necessary durability and protection. Always use paint specifically formulated for floors.


  1. How long does floor paint last?

  • The longevity of floor paint depends on the type of paint, quality, and level of traffic. High-quality paints can last 5-10 years or more with proper care and maintenance.


  1. Can I apply floor paint myself?

  • Yes, many types of floor paint are suitable for DIY projects. Be sure to follow the manufacturer's instructions for preparation, application, and curing times.


  1. How long should I wait before using a newly painted floor?

  • Allow the floor paint to cure completely before using the floor. This can take anywhere from a few days to a week, depending on the type of paint and environmental conditions.


  1. How do I clean painted floors?

  • Painted floors can be cleaned with a mild detergent and water.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ners that may damage the paint finish.
